Clay “to increase and disseminate mathematical knowledge.” The seven problems, which were announced in 2000, are the Riemann hypothesis, P versus NP problem, Birch and Swinnerton-Dyer conjecture, Hodge conjecture, Navier-Stokes equation, Yang-Mills theory, and Poincaré conjecture.What math equation is impossible?
For decades, a math puzzle has stumped the smartest mathematicians in the world. x3+y3+z3=k, with k being all the numbers from one to 100, is a Diophantine equation that's sometimes known as "summing of three cubes." When there are two or more unknowns, as is the case here, only the integers are studied.What is the most advanced math?

While pure math is deductive and specialized, applied math requires that same capacity for deductive reasoning, but also a much broader knowledge of particular application areas of science and technology.Is calculus pure or applied?
Generally-speaking, the early pioneers of calculus were applied mathematicians. In fact, people such as Newton and Gauss are more famous as scientists than as mathematicians. They created and used their mathematics in order to model physical reality. This is what applied mathematics is about.Is applied math harder than calculus?
